The Sixth, Lincoln Square’s cocktail bar located at 2202 W Lawrence Ave from The Fifty/50 Restaurant Group, is debuting “OY To The World”, Chicago’s first and only half-Hanukkah and half-Christmas pop-up bar this holiday season. From Friday, December 3 through Sunday, January 9, guests can choose from a festive lineup of specialty cocktails and small bites as well as several photo opportunities throughout the bar.

The Fifty/50 Restaurant Group is bringing the 50/50 split via “OY To The World”, offering holiday spirit for guests looking to immerse themselves in all things Christmas, Hanukkah, or both. With a distinct dividing line down the middle of the bar that splits the bar into two festive themes, guests will enter into a head-to-toe shimmering Hanukkah blowout, then head back into a classic Christmas bar, complete with twinkling Christmas lights and a ceiling overtaken by colorful hanging ornaments. 

Throughout the bar guests will notice walls filled with fun and “cheeky” quotes that celebrate the both holidays. Guests can deck the halls with matzo balls, boogie-down in a Hanukkah disco party and snap a selfie with life-size cutouts of Elf on the Shelf and Mensch on a Bench. Or even sneak away for a kiss in the “Mistletoe Makeout Corner.” 

“We’re constantly thinking of new ways to push the envelope and deliver unforgettable, first-of-its-kind experiences to each of our guests,” said Greg Mohr, co-owner of The Fifty/50 Restaurant Group. “We’ve had a long-time vision of blending cherished traditions into new and unique activations that bring people together in celebration. ‘OY To The World’ does just that. I’m thrilled for Chicago to experience this one-of-a-kind pop-up and ring in the holidays with us — whichever one they may celebrate —in style!”  

At “OY To The World”, the Red-Nosed Reindeer meets the Rabbi. The pop-up bar offers a menu of six small bites from executive chef Nate Henssler that incorporate a spin on otherwise traditional holiday dishes and eight new cocktails created by lead bartender Eric De Toro Acevedo.
